First, make sure that your website is easy to navigate. This means that all links should be easy to find and that the menus should be well organized. Providing an easy-to-use navigation system makes it easier for visitors to find the content they’re looking for without feeling frustrated or confused.

Second, create interesting content that encourages visitors to stay. People want to find relevant, useful content that helps them with what they’re looking for. Keep your content up to date and make sure that it’s compelling and engaging.

Third, keep your website design simple yet appealing. Visitors don’t want to be overwhelmed with too much information or too many images. Make sure that your website is visually appealing and that it’s easy to read.

Fourth, use internal links to keep visitors on your website. Internal links are links from one page on your website to another page on your website. These links allow your visitors to explore more of your website and find out more about what you offer.

Fifth, optimize your website for mobile devices. With more and more people using their smartphones and tablets to search online, it’s important to make sure that your website is optimized for mobile devices. This means that your website should look good on any device, be easy to read, and be easy to navigate.

Sixth, use visuals to capture attention. Images, videos, and infographics can be great tools to keep your visitors interested and engaged. They also make it easier to share your website and content on social media.

Seventh, provide high-quality customer support. Whether this is through a website chat service, a telephone line, or an email address, make sure that customers have a way to ask questions and to get help.

Eight, be consistent with your message. Consistency keeps visitors on your website longer because they know what to expect. Make sure you’re consistent in your tone, messaging, and overall design.

Finally, make sure you have clear calls-to-action. Calls-to-action should be strategically placed throughout your website, informing visitors of what they can do next, such as signing up for a newsletter, downloading a guide, or purchasing a product.

2. Guide your visitors through your website with CTAs


The second strategy to keep your visitors on your website is to guide them through it using calls to action (CTAs). CTAs provide a well-defined path for your visitor to follow and should be strategically placed throughout your website. By giving users an explicit prompt that tells them what action to take next, it takes the guesswork out of their navigation.

Here are some tips for adding CTAs to your website:

• Use action-oriented words such as “Download”, “Sign Up”, “Register”, or “Subscribe” on your CTAs.

• Place your CTAs in highly visible locations such as on the homepage, in the header or footer, or in the sidebar.

• Add a CTA button to the end of every blog post or article.

• Choose a contrasting color for your CTAs so that they stand out from the rest of the page.

• Don’t be afraid to try out different CTAs to see which ones have the most success.

• Make sure your CTAs are easy to find and understand, with a clear path to completion.

Adding CTAs to your website is a great way to help guide your visitors and keep them engaged. The more detailed and specific your CTAs, the more likely your visitors are to click through and take the desired action. By giving them a clear call to take the next step, you’ll be able to keep your visitors on your website for longer.

Add a small contact form right on that page


Adding a small contact form right on the page is an important strategy to keep your website visitors engaged. This can be done in a way that it doesn’t distract the user from their experience, while allowing them to quickly get in touch with the website owner or team.

A small contact form should be prominently displayed on the page, in a place that is easy to find. It should only take a few seconds for a user to fill out the form, so it’s best to keep it as simple as possible by only asking for basic information like name, email, and message. If you’re looking for more detailed feedback, you can also add more fields, such as an ‘other’ field for open-ended answers.

In terms of design, it is important to keep the form simple and easy-to-understand. Choose a font that’s easy to read and make sure that the labels and text boxes are clearly visible. If you’re using a form builder, you can customize the look and feel of your form to match the design of your website.

Finally, make sure that your contact form is secure and spam-proof. There are a number of ways to achieve this, such as using captcha, adding a honeypot field, and using an email validation service. This way, you can ensure that only genuine messages are sent and that your website is kept safe from malicious bots.

By adding a small contact form, you will allow visitors to get in touch with you quickly, without having to leave the page and go to another page to contact you. This is an essential strategy if you want to keep visitors engaged and interested in what you have to offer.

3. Don’t make it difficult to find things on your website


Many websites are designed with the primary goal of getting visitors through the door. However, keeping them there is just as important. Unfortunately, many websites make it difficult for visitors to find what they’re looking for, resulting in a high bounce rate and lower engagement.

If you want your visitors to stay, you must make it easy for them to find what they need. Implementing the following strategies can help improve the user experience on your website, resulting in longer visits and higher engagement rates:

1. Establish clear navigation paths – Establish a clear hierarchy of navigation links that are easy to find, understand and use.

2. Utilize visual cues – Utilizing visual cues, such as arrows and other symbols, can help make it easier for visitors to find what they’re looking for.

3. Have a well-labeled search bar – A well-labeled search bar located at the top of the page can be a great way for visitors to find what they’re looking for quickly.

4. Utilize breadcrumb navigation – Breadcrumb navigation allows visitors to easily trace the steps of their search and return to a parent page quickly.

5. Create a sitemap – A sitemap can help visitors quickly find the content they are looking for.

6. Include a “contact us” page – An easy to find page that allows visitors to get in touch with you can be a great asset to keep them coming back.

7. Use related links – Utilizing related links at the bottom of articles and blog posts can help visitors find additional content.

By implementing these strategies, you can ensure that your visitors have the best possible experience on your website. This can help improve your website's engagement and keep visitors coming back.

7. Link to other content in your website


One of the best ways to keep visitors on your website is to provide them with links to other content within your site. Linking to your own content can help visitors make more of an effort to stay on your page, as they will have access to more information and resources.

Creating internal links to other content can also help you boost your search engine optimization (SEO) efforts. Search engines take into account how many links there are within your website to determine how trustworthy and authoritative your site is – and the more internal links you have, the more likely it is that search engines will rank your page higher.

When creating internal links, opt for descriptive anchor text that clearly indicates to your visitors where the link will take them. This helps make your links more useful to your readers, as well as for the search engine bots that are searching for keywords and topics related to your website.

It is also important to keep in mind where you should link to in order to keep visitors engaged and on your page. Linking to relevant content, such as related blog posts, reviews, or case studies, will give your visitors more relevant information that they can use while they are still on your website.

Including links to content that is external to your website can also be beneficial. You can link to trusted sources, such as industry news sites or blogs, in order to provide your visitors with more knowledge and facts related to the topic they are interested in.

By providing helpful and relevant links to other content within and outside of your website, you can help keep your visitors engaged and on your page longer. This will help you to build trust with your visitors, as well as improve your ranking with search engines.

9. Add related posts


Adding related posts is a great way to keep visitors on your website. This tactic is used by many websites to increase the amount of time people spend on the website. It allows visitors to find content that is related to what they are currently reading, making them more likely to stay on the website to browse through related content.

Related posts are usually automatically generated by the website. The website's algorithm reviews the content that the visitor is currently viewing and then generates a list of related posts that might interest the visitor. The related posts are usually displayed at the end of the current post, giving the visitor the option to view more content that might interest them.

The benefits of this strategy are numerous. Firstly, it gives the visitor more content to explore. Secondly, it can help to reduce the bounce rate of the website. This is because when visitors land on a page and finish reading it, they often either back out of the page or close the website. However, when the related posts feature is used, it gives the visitors the option to continue browsing and find more content that interests them, reducing the bounce rate.

Adding related posts to your website can be a great way to keep visitors on your site for longer and reduce your bounce rate. Not only does it give the visitor a way to find more content that interests them, but it can also help to keep your website relevant and up-to-date.

11. Care for legibility and readability


Legibility and readability are two of the most important aspects of any website, as they affect user experience. Legibility is the font used on the website and readability is the structure of the content. To keep your website visitors' attention, it is essential to have a legible and readable website.

First and foremost, choose font styles and sizes that are easy to read. Use a font size that is large enough that content is easily readable from the screen, and pick a font style that is not too ornate or too thin. Pay particular attention to the font colour: use a colour that has good contrast for effective reading. The best font choices are sans serif fonts such as Arial and Verdana, as they are easier to read than serif fonts such as Times New Roman.

Next, make sure the content is structured in a readable format. Break down the text into small chunks with subheadings and paragraphs, use bullet points and numbered lists for long lists, and use clear visuals such as images, infographics, and videos to illustrate points. Keep the text short and to the point, and use language that is easy to understand.

Finally, ensure that the page is properly designed. Pay attention to the page layout and use visuals to draw attention to key areas. Space out text and visuals evenly, use different font sizes to highlight important areas, and use images to break up long paragraphs of text.

By taking the time to ensure your website is legible and readable, you can create a better user experience for your website visitors and help keep their attention on your website.
